THE TEAM
The Partnerships and Alliances team is responsible for driving revenue growth through our partner ecosystem. We define strategic new business initiatives to grow our market segment share, and identify new product partnerships to extend the reach of Lever’s product suite. We deliver direct revenue to Lever’s Sales team through partner referrals and a revenue share model with our partners. This work is fast-paced and involves interacting with and influencing both external and internal stakeholders.

THE LEVER STORY
Lever builds modern recruiting software for teams to source, interview, and hire top talent. Our team strives to set a new bar for enterprise software with modern, well-designed, real-time apps. We participated in Y Combinator in summer 2012, and since then have raised $73 million. As the applicant tracking system of choice for Netflix, Eventbrite, ClearSlide, change.org, and thousands more leading companies, Lever means you hire the best by hiring together.
